Symbiotic association means one of the organisms, called endosymbiont, is present inside the cells of its host. The most typical examples are endosymbiosis theory of mitochondria and chloroplasts which, according to some theories, are cellular organelles of bacterial origin.
But these theories are still discussed because there are in fact arguments that support endosymbiosis theory and also arguments that disapprove it.

The
peripheral nervous system (PNS) consists of nerves that transmit impulses back
and forth between the central nervous system, the skeletal muscles, and the
skin.
<span>The
PNS consists of the nerves and ganglia that are located outside the brain and
spinal cord (CNS). The main function of the PNS is the connection between the
brain and spinal cord and the rest of the body.</span>

- The rate by which the turnover of the molecules takes place in a metabolic pathway that regulates the flow of material is termed as metabolic flux or simply flux.
- The various enzymes that are involved in the metabolic pathway are responsible for regulating the flux.
- The flux varies with the different states of activity of a person and it is important for the regulation of metabolic activities as well as maintain the homeostasis of the body.
- The mathematical expression to calculate the flux is :
J = Vf - Vi
Where J = flux of metabolites
Vf = rate of the forward reaction
Vi = rate of the reverse reaction
